The world’s health workforce almost tripled between 1990 and 2023, rising from 40.9 million to 122.1 million workers. Women drove most of that increase and represented 68.9% of the workforce in 2023. But the expansion was uneven: women remain concentrated in nursing, midwifery and other care roles that generally offer less pay, status and access to leadership, while many regions still lack enough workers to deliver essential services.
A new analysis based on Global Burden of Disease (GBD) 2023 estimates that the world would need another 34.4 million doctors, nurses, midwives, dentists and pharmacists to reach a moderate level of universal health coverage (UHC), defined in the analysis as a UHC effective-coverage index score of at least 80 out of 100.
A much larger workforce, but not an equitable one
Across 20 health-worker cadres, the estimated global workforce increased by 81.2 million between 1990 and 2023. By 2023, it included approximately:
33.2 million nurses and midwives
15.1 million doctors
7.6 million community health workers
6.8 million pharmacists and pharmaceutical assistants
6.1 million dentists and dental assistants
Women’s participation was central to this growth. However, representation has not translated into equal influence across the health system. Women made up most nurses, midwives and community health workers, while fewer than half of doctors were women in the reported estimates. That pattern reflects a gendered division of labour: women are heavily represented in essential frontline and caregiving work but remain less represented in occupations and decision-making positions associated with higher pay and authority.

The distinction matters because simply counting workers can obscure who performs the work, how that work is valued and who controls workforce priorities. A health system can become larger without becoming more equal or more effective at retaining skilled professionals.
Why the estimated gap is 34.4 million workers
The GBD 2023 analysis does not define a shortage simply as the number of vacant posts. Instead, it compares workforce density with the lowest observed density in countries that reached a UHC effective-coverage score of 80 or higher. The resulting thresholds are empirical benchmarks linked to service coverage, rather than universal staffing rules for every country.
Using those benchmarks, the estimated global additions needed in 2023 were:
Profession
Additional workers estimated to be needed
Doctors
7.1 million
Nurses and midwives
23.9 million
Dentists
1.8 million
Pharmacists
1.6 million
Total
34.4 million
The largest component is nurses and midwives, whose estimated gap is more than three times the doctor shortfall. That finding reinforces why workforce planning cannot focus on producing more physicians alone. Primary care, nursing, midwifery, oral health, pharmacy and community-based services all contribute to effective coverage.
The workforce-density benchmarks have changed
An earlier GBD-based study, using 2019 data, estimated that countries needed at least the following densities per 10,000 people to reach a UHC effective-coverage score of 80:
20.7 physicians
70.6 nurses and midwives
8.2 dentistry personnel
9.4 pharmaceutical personnel
The newer analysis reports different observed thresholds—approximately 23.8 doctors, 64.5 nurses and midwives, 5.2 dentists and 5.6 pharmacists per 10,000 people.
These figures should not be read as a contradiction or as a single fixed global standard. The studies use different data vintages and estimation procedures. The newer approach is based on observed workforce densities among countries meeting the UHC threshold, while the earlier analysis produced minimum benchmark densities from its own modelling framework. Changes in data coverage, country performance and methodology can therefore change the estimated threshold and the resulting gap.
South Asia has the largest absolute gap
South Asia has the largest estimated shortfall in absolute terms: about 13.6 million additional workers across the five professional groups. The reported regional breakdown includes approximately 2.6 million doctors, 10.0 million nurses and midwives, 0.7 million dentists and 0.3 million pharmacists.
Population size is a major reason South Asia’s total gap is so large. The region’s challenge is therefore both numerical and organisational: it must expand the workforce while ensuring that workers are distributed across rural, poorer and underserved communities.
Sub-Saharan Africa presents a different but equally severe problem. It had the lowest workforce densities for nearly all major cadres in 2023, with community health workers the main exception, while high-income countries had the highest densities.
The contrast shows why a single global number can mislead. South Asia has the largest absolute requirement, whereas sub-Saharan Africa faces exceptionally low availability relative to population and need. Both regions require more workers, but the policy response must be tailored to local population growth, disease burden, training capacity and retention conditions.
Why the estimate is higher than some WHO figures
The 34.4-million estimate is not directly comparable with every figure published by WHO. WHO shortage estimates may use different years, occupational categories, definitions of need and planning horizons. For example, a WHO summary reported a needs-based shortage of 20 million workers in 2013, falling to 15 million in 2020 and projected to reach 10 million by 2030.
The GBD estimate answers a different question: how many doctors, nurses, midwives, dentists and pharmacists would be needed to reach an effective UHC coverage score of 80, using observed workforce-density thresholds from countries that meet that benchmark.
A higher GBD estimate does not automatically invalidate a lower WHO estimate. The figures become misleading only when they are presented as if they measure the same target, occupations, year and definition of shortage.
Recruitment alone will not close the gap
Training and hiring are necessary, but adding workers without improving the conditions of work can produce rapid turnover, poor distribution and migration away from underserved areas. A durable workforce strategy needs to address the entire employment pipeline:
Education: expand training capacity while maintaining faculty, clinical placements and quality standards.
Distribution: create incentives and support systems for workers in rural and underserved areas.
Retention: improve pay, safety, workload management, social protection and career progression.
Gender equity: address unequal pay, harassment, discrimination, unpaid care burdens and opaque promotion systems.
Leadership: ensure women have meaningful representation in management, policy and professional decision-making.
Skills mix: invest in nursing, midwifery, pharmacy, oral health, community health workers, primary care and referral systems—not only physicians.
The central lesson is a paradox: the global health workforce expanded by more than 80 million people, largely through women’s labour, yet many health systems remain far below the workforce capacity associated with even moderate UHC. Closing that gap requires more than recruitment. It requires valuing the roles already doing much of the work, distributing workers more fairly and building institutions that enable them to stay and lead.
